All you want to know about riarch, mayani.
Placements: There is a compulsory one-year internship program after passing the final year. Since the college is private, there is no paid internship. It is divided into two six-month halves. For the first six months, there is an internship at the college's hospital, and for the next six months, at a government hospital of your choice. After completing the internship, one can apply for NEET PG for higher studies or apply for a job independently. Since the college is well-reputed, one can get an average-salary job at the start, with a package of INR 3–4 LPA. One can also start their own clinic or hospital, so in general, there is a 100% chance of getting a job or earning.
Infrastructure: College campus and college: Overall, the campus is average, with good space and parking, good security, and cleanliness. There are CCTVs almost everywhere on campus. The college is also good, with good classrooms that are cleaned every day, separate departments for every subject, good teachers and equipment for practicals, and Wi-Fi throughout the campus. There is also a big library and a study room with separate sections for girls and boys.
Hostel and mess: The hostels and mess are good compared to other colleges. Hostels have attached washrooms for every room and a supply of hot water throughout the day. They also have a water filter for the hostel, with clean drinking water all day and night, as well as Wi-Fi with average speed. The mess is also good, with a fee of INR 35,000 per year, including breakfast, lunch, and dinner.
Extracurricular activities: The college conducts sports and cultural competitions, gatherings, and health camps every year to improve students' extracurricular interactions.
Faculty: Teachers are experienced doctors who help us with all our doubts and have great teaching experience. There are two internal exams every year and one university exam conducted by MUHS, Nashik University, to get promoted to the next year. These exams and viva voce make us ready for handling patients in hospitals.
